This holiday season will be extra special for several members of the royal family, including Meghan Markle, Princess Eugenie and Princess Beatrice.
The proud moms will celebrate a major milestone when December rolls around. As Hello! magazine points out, it will be all of their babies’ first Christmas. (Just let that sink in.)
This goes for Princess Eugenie, who gave birth to her son, August Brooksbank, in February. In June, Markle welcomed a daughter named Lilibet Diana Mountbatten-Windsor. Princess Beatrice rounded out the royal baby boom, announcing the arrival of her daughter, Sienna Mapelli Mozzi, in September.
Unfortunately, we don’t know where the families will celebrate Christmas. However, word on the street is that Queen Elizabeth will reportedly host local relatives at her Norfolk estate, Sandringham.
